Sitecode: 1844
The campsite is – as always – fantastic. The pitches are a bit short, but even a 10-meter car can back into the grass with its overhang. There are now signs everywhere with a QR code, making it easy to pay and select the number of nights. It works perfectly, and the city official only comes by to politely remind campers who haven't paid yet; cash payments are no longer accepted. €4 per night in February.
Sitecode: 103224
wonderful! very nice reception by Mr. Hanewald, fantastic location, electricity 2 €, very large single site with a great view of the beautiful nature. Clean toilet, nice hiking trails. With larger vehicles, it is best to take the street "in den Langwiesen" to Pochelstrasse. drive in, the curve at the beginning of Pochelstrasse. is a bit tight.
Sitecode: 9628
Nice parking space, cheap at 10 € per night and electricity 2 kw for 1 €. Entrance could be a bit bigger. The right side of the bathroom can be reached with disposal without a barrier. The pitches down by the Moselle have no electricity on the bathroom side. Pay machine only takes cash. Unfortunately a bit noisy from the buses and cars on the bridge and across the street - but really quiet at night.
Sitecode: 6553
very nice place right on the Moselle. Also nice in February when the weather is bad, good opportunity to dispose of even for 9 meter womis and very nice people from the community who come by to collect - 12 € including electricity and disposal is more than fair! Bakers and butchers within walking distance, Edeka is a little further, but also doable!
Sitecode: 58860
great place, good location, easy to reach with a 9 meter Womo, nice, incredibly helpful staff at the reception. Dog shower, bicycle shower, good sanitary facilities. were there over Christmas and space was only half full - totally enjoyable.
Sitecode: 100975
all sanitary facilities in dec. 22 still closed. nice space, also great for 8.90 Womo-unfortunately really nasty granulate that sticks everywhere when it rains. nothing to eat nearby, place extremely lonely. Great for a night's sleep.
Sitecode: 12356
perfectly fine for 1 night. unfortunately very muddy after heavy rain, but that's not the place's fault. Also easily accessible with a 8.90 meter Womo and quiet at night, traffic stops when the surrounding restaurants close. very many nearby restaurants.
